📍 Destination Overview
Barranquilla, Colombia's fourth city at the Magdalena River mouth, is the leading Caribbean port, called the Golden Gate. Its February Carnival, second only to Rio's, is UNESCO-listed. Birthplace of Nobel laureate Gabriel Garcia Marquez, its Caribbean spirit and river culture shaped his magical realism.

☀️ Best Time to Visit & Climate
🌸 Best Season: Apr–Jun
Drier, warm Apr–Jun keeps the old town and Caribbean riverfront lively.
🍂 Best Season: Sep–Oct
In the Sep–Oct dry gaps, carnival culture and museums are easier to enjoy.
